About The Book
The understanding of the acts of worship according to the Maliki school of Islamic law. Imam al-Akhdari is an Algerian scholar whose full name is Abu Yazid 'Abdur Rahman bin Muhammad al-Saghir bin Muḥammad bin Amir.
He is most commonly known as "al-Akhdari." He followed the Maliki school in fiqh and the Ash'ari school in creed. He is considered to be from amongst the great scholars of Islam and the distinguished scholars of Algeria in the 10th century Hijra.
